Earlier this morning, Final Fantasy XIV Producer and Director Naoki Yoshida took to the internet to talk about next week’s Patch 5.35 update as well as as upcoming Patch 5.4.

Patch 5.35 will arrive next week on October 13. The major points of the patch include:

  • The Bozjan Southern Front
  • Resistance Weapon Upgrades
  • Skysteel Tool Upgrades
  • Additional Housing- 3 Wards and Subdivisions in all residential areas

Patch 5.4

Patch 5.4, titled Futures Rewritten, is currently aiming at an early December release.

  • New Main Scenario Quests
  • New Instanced Dungeon
    • Matoya’s Relict
      • Trust system compatible
  • New Chronicles of a New Era Quests
    • The Sorrow of Werlyt
  • New Trials
    • Emerald Weapon Battle (Name TBC)
    • Extreme Emerald Weapon Battle (Name TBC)
  • New Raid Dungeon
    • Eden’s Promise
    • Eden’s Promise (Savage)
    • *Completion of main scenario quests from patch 5.3 will be required.
  • Job Adjustments
    • PvE Adjustments
    • PvP Adjustments
  • Blue Mage Update
    • Level cap will be raised from 60 to 70.
    • New spells and blue mage exclusive gear will be added.
    • New duties will be added to the blue mage log.
  • Save the Queen Update
    • Resistance weapon upgrades
    • Delubrum Reginae
      • Normal: 24 players, no role requirements for matching.
      • Savage: 48 players, players must form parties before entering.
  • Crafter Update
    • Less frequently used actions will be adjusted.
    • New crafting conditions will be added for expert recipes.
    • These conditions will not appear for recipes added prior to Patch 5.4.
  • Gatherer Update
    • Collectable and aetherial reduction systems have been revamped.
    • The Collectable Glove option will be removed.
    • Item wear will be removed, putting a focus on gathering attempts and collectability rating.
    • Elevation of gathering points can be discerned on the map.
    • Fish Eyes will be adjusted.
      • Will no longer be required to catch fish.
      • Will allow players to ignore the time requirement for catching fish.
  • Ishgardian Restoration Update
    • Fourth phase of the restoration begins!
    • The restoration is scheduled to reach completion.
    • Commemorated with construction of a monumne.t
      • Monument based on the crafting class with greatest contributions during a certain period.
  • Unreal Trial Update
    • A new trial will be selected.
  • Treasure Hunt Update
    • Delve deeper into the secrets of Lyhe Ghiah.
  • Ocean Fishing Update
    • New routes will be added.
    • Additional objectives will be added.
      • Completing these objectives will add bonus points to your score.
    • ‘Reembarking after abandoning a voyage will be restricted.
  • Triple Triad Update
    • Rules and UI will be revamped for ease of play.
    • New rules and tournaments will be added.
      • A new ruleset to battle opponents with a deck of randomly chosen cards.
      • Periodically held tournaments.
  • Doman Mahjong Update
    • Tonpusen (Quick Match) now available.
    • UI will be adjusted.
      • Dora indicator can be changed to show the tile before dora instead.
      • The discard pile indicates whether a tile is “tsumokiri” (discarded immediately after it was drawn) or not.
  • Miscellaneous Updates
    • New violin instruments will be added.
    • New system for affixing multiple materia.
    • Abililty to link quests in the chat window.

Playing on PlayStation 5

  • The PlayStation 4 version of Final Fantasy XIV can be used to play on PlayStation 5.
  • PS4 Pro settings in the System Configuration menu will be available.
  • PlayStation 5 hardware will ensure quick load times.

After the break, UI Designer Kei Odagiri came onto the broadcast to discuss his role and talk about some of the things they have worked on.

  • Explorer Mode
    • Freely explore dungeons you’ve previously completed.
    • Players will be able to explore dungeons added in the 5.x series, with more to be added in the future.
    • No enemies will appear, and all objectives will be cleared.
    • Mounts, minions, and fashion accessories allowed during excursions.
    • Striking dummies can be placed to allow for actions to be used.

Fan Festival Status Update

At this time, the North American, Japanese, and European Fan Festivals have all been cancelled.

The team will be hosting an event in February 2021 to announce new information. A 14-hour broadcast will be held on the same day. They are also still considering switching to a digital Fan Festival and ask that you stand by for further information.

Community Finder

Alongside the October 13 update, the Lodestone will see a Community Finder feature added to it, which will allow players to recruit and find in-game communities.

To mark the occasion, there will be a Community Finder Release Campaign that will run from October 13 to October 27. By posting a free company recruitment listing on the Community Finder during the campaign period, members have a chance to receive in-game items.

Final Fantasy XIV Print Collection (Tentative Name)

Last but certainly not least, its been announced that Square Enix is looking to make the Final Fantasy XIV art prints, (which were previously only available in Japan), available overseas. The prints certainly aren’t cheap, listed at a price point of 30,000 yen (around $300 USD), but it’s certainly something for collectors and art lovers to keep an eye out for.
